Description
During a lull in the fighting of Operation Bribie, two pilots from No 9 Iroquois Squadron, O37576 Flt Lt Robert Andrew (Bob) MacIntosh, of Ainslie, ACT (front right), and O219176 Flight Lieutenant (Flt Lt) Leslie Wilfred (Les) Morris, of Frenches Forest, NSW, (rear) grab a quick meal at the Vung Tau Air Base, South Vietnam, before returning to their aircraft. These men along with A56669 Leading Aircraftman (LAC) Brian Boyd (Ron) Hill, of Subiaco, WA and A18504 LAC Brian V Taylor, of Rockhampton, Qld, flew the Bell UH-1B Iroquois A2-1019 during Operation Bribie. This aircraft is now part of the Australian War Memorial's collection.
